Margot Robbie’s ‘Wuthering Heights’ Comment Sparks Open Marriage Rumors With Tom Ackerley
Margot Robbie has sparked online chatter after a brief comment she made at a movie premiere caught fans by surprise.
The moment happened during the Los Angeles premiere of Wuthering Heights. While walking the red carpet, Robbie spoke to reporters about how she would personally choose to watch the film once it hits theaters. Her answer seemed casual at first, but one line quickly became the focus of attention.
She explained that the film’s release date, just before Valentine’s Day, was meant to fit different kinds of movie plans. If it was me, I’d want to go with all my girlfriends on a Friday night, I’d want to have cocktails, maybe dress up a little bit, Robbie said. She then added, Then I’d go with my husband… or whoever, on Valentine’s Day. So it felt like the perfect weekend to release it.

That small phrase, or whoever, immediately stood out to fans. Many people online began questioning whether the comment hinted at something more about her marriage to Tom Ackerley.
The interview clip was later posted on TikTok by The Hollywood Reporter. Viewers flooded the comments with reactions, jokes, and theories. Some fans even connected the moment to Robbie’s past roles, with one person pointing out how the Galentine’s-style comment echoed a well-known line from Barbie, tonight’s girls night.
Despite the speculation, Ackerley was present at the premiere alongside Robbie. The couple also worked together behind the scenes, as both produced the film through their company, LuckyChap Entertainment. Wuthering Heights stars Robbie opposite Jacob Elordi, and their on-screen chemistry has already become a major talking point.
Robbie and Ackerley have been together for years. They first met on a film set in 2013, launched LuckyChap soon after, and married privately in 2016. In late 2024, they welcomed their first child, a baby boy.

The movie is directed by Emerald Fennell and is a new take on Emily Brontë’s classic novel. The story centers on a dark and obsessive romance. The cast also includes Hong Chau, Shazad Latif, Alison Oliver, and Ewan Mitchell, with music by Charli XCX.
The film’s look has also drawn attention, especially the bold outfits worn by Robbie’s character. Some scenes feature Victorian-inspired fashion mixed with modern edge, which Robbie herself joked about during interviews.
Outside of this project, Robbie remains busy as a producer. After the huge success of Barbie, she is working on new projects, including films based on The Sims and Monopoly. She is also expected to team up again with Bradley Cooper for a long-discussed Ocean’s Eleven prequel.
Wuthering Heights is set to release in theaters on February 13. Early reactions describe it as intense and provocative, similar in tone to Fennell’s earlier work, Saltburn.
